Dubrovnik is a remarkable city with a rich history. Situated on the picturesque coast of Croatia, it comes alive during the summer months with visitors from all over the world. The medieval charm, UNESCO Old Town, and the breathtaking Adriatic Sea make it a top destination in Croatia.

Despite facing issues with overcrowding, there are still ways to enjoy the local lifestyle away from the hustle and bustle if you know where to look.

I’ve been to Dubrovnik multiple times and have noticed the increase in hotel options over the years. To help you plan your trip, here are my top picks for the best hotels in Dubrovnik:

1. Art Hotel

Image Source: www.nomadicmatt.com

This hotel is located right by the beach in Lapad and offers cozy three-star accommodations. The rooms are decorated in light, natural colors with touches of colorful artwork. Some rooms have balconies with nice views, as well as amenities like air conditioning, flat-screen TVs, minibars, and desks. While the bathrooms are not very spacious and the showers are a bit small, they are nicely decorated with colorful tiles and come with slippers, complimentary toiletries, and good water pressure. The staff is friendly and the complimentary continental breakfast is a delicious spread of local homemade food that changes daily. The best part about this hotel is its unbeatable location near the beach!

2. Hotel Adria

Image Source: www.nomadicmatt.com

This serene four-star hotel features two swimming pools, a spa, and a fitness center, making it an ideal choice for travelers seeking relaxation. The rooms are generously sized and well-lit, with large beds and expansive windows that allow plenty of natural light to filter through. The decor is understated, with soothing white and tan hues. Most rooms offer balconies overlooking the marina, along with amenities such as a flat-screen TV, desk, safe, and coffee/tea maker. The bathrooms are also spacious and bright, with invigorating water pressure in the showers. Guests can enjoy a diverse buffet breakfast each morning, complete with fresh fruit, pastries, juice, and cereals. Complimentary use of the hotel’s parking garage is available for those arriving by car.

3. Royal Palm Hotel

This luxurious five-star hotel located in the Lapad neighborhood is a fantastic option for those seeking affordable luxury. While the rooms may have a slightly outdated feel with their carpet and décor, they make up for it with their spaciousness and airy atmosphere. Plus, many of the rooms provide stunning ocean views that are simply breathtaking. Each room is equipped with essential amenities such as a TV, electric kettle, desk, minibar, and conveniently located outlets near the bed. The bathrooms are also impressive, boasting stylish tile or marble, cozy bathrobes, and complimentary toiletries. For those looking to indulge, some rooms even feature deep soaking tubs.

One of the highlights of staying at this hotel is the complimentary breakfast buffet, which offers a wide variety of options. From an egg station to mimosas and fresh pastries, there’s something to satisfy every palate. Additionally, guests can enjoy the hotel’s relaxing spa, pool, and gym facilities. And if you’re a beach lover, you’ll be pleased to know that the beach is just a short distance away. However, what truly sets this hotel apart is its on-site terrace restaurant, which provides sweeping panoramic views of the stunning Adriatic. It’s the perfect spot to enjoy a delicious meal while taking in the breathtaking scenery.

 

4. Hotel Lero

Located in the Montovjerna neighborhood, this charming four-star hotel boasts a serene outdoor pool. The rooms offer stunning views of the Adriatic Sea, spacious layouts, and unique design elements like vibrant artwork or murals. Each room is equipped with air conditioning, minibars, coffeemakers, satellite TV, and ample storage space.

The bathrooms are modest, but the showers have excellent water pressure, luxurious bathrobes are provided, and some rooms feature both a bathtub and a shower. Guests can enjoy a variety of dining options on-site, including a poolside bar, an acclaimed Bosnian restaurant, and a Mediterranean eatery that serves a complimentary daily breakfast buffet catering to all dietary preferences.

 

5. Hotel More

This exquisite hotel is situated right on the edge of a cliff, overlooking the glistening Adriatic Sea. With its five-star rating, every room in this hotel offers a balcony that provides breathtaking views of the shimmering waters. What sets this hotel apart is its one-of-a-kind bar, the Cave Bar More, which is located inside an actual cave by the water.

The rooms here are incredibly spacious, featuring incredibly comfortable beds, an abundance of natural light, and soothing color schemes. The furnishings are simple yet elegant, with wooden desks and a separate seating area that includes a sofa or cozy chairs. In-room amenities include a desk, a flat screen TV, a coffee/tea maker, a minibar, and a safe. The bathrooms are also generously sized and come equipped with slippers, plush bathrobes, luxurious toiletries, and excellent water pressure.

To start your day off right, the hotel offers a complimentary breakfast buffet each morning. Indulge in fresh fruit, cereal, eggs, and pastries to satisfy your cravings.

If you’re looking to treat yourself to a luxurious experience, this hotel is the perfect choice for you.

6. St. Joseph’s Hotel

Located in a charming 16th-century building close to two stunning beaches, St. Joseph’s stands out as one of the rare hotels nestled within the Old Town walls. You can take your pick between standard hotel rooms and studio/apartment rooms. Regardless of your choice, each room boasts its own unique charm, featuring design elements such as hardwood floors, exposed brick walls, wooden ceiling beams, elegant chandeliers, and antique furnishings. The ambiance feels more like a cozy B&B rather than a traditional hotel. Enjoy modern amenities like flat-screen TVs, a desk, and coffee/tea makers. The larger rooms even come equipped with kitchen and laundry facilities.

The bathrooms are equally impressive, showcasing beautiful tile or marble finishes, invigorating rain showers (some even have luxurious bathtubs), soft slippers, and plush bathrobes. One standout feature is the complimentary a la carte breakfast, prepared by a skilled chef and delivered to your room each morning. This thoughtful gesture adds a personal touch that truly enhances the overall guest experience.
